PREVIOUS BOARD/BOARD COMMITTEE ACTIONS:
By Resolution Number (No.) 20-018 (February 25, 2020), the Board of Supervisors (BOS) approved BOS Agreement No. 20-016/Department of Transportation (DOT) Agreement No. 190088 with Schaaf & Wheeler Consulting Civil Engineers (Schaaf & Wheeler) to perform the Stormwater Trash Capture Feasibility Study.

SUMMARY OF REQUEST:
On June 1, 2017, the State Water Resources Control Board issued Water Code Section 13383 Order letters (Order) requiring Phase II Small Municipal Separate Storm Sewer System (MS4) permittees to submit a method to comply with new statewide Trash Provisions. Under DOT Agreement No. 190088, Schaaf & Wheeler developed a comprehensive stormwater trash capture feasibility study as a preliminary step to compliance with the order.
